CO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 Savannah launched the Community Advancement Leadership Institute in early April to offer residents free and affordable classes in community, nonprofit, career, and youth leadership, with sessions open for registration until Aug. 26 and a second round beginning in September. The program will also feature events—such as Super Saturdays and a neighborhood convention on Dec. 13—and associations completing five core trainings will be eligible for a $1,000 grant. - ➤ Tybee Island officials held a press conference today to explain plans for Saturday’s Orange Crush event, saying that all main activities will be held on Saturday to limit disruptions. They warned that residents and visitors should expect heavy traffic, limited parking & a strong first responder presence as police set up a checkpoint along Highway 80. WJCL

- ➤ Georgia Southern University and East Georgia State College will consolidate today as the Board of Regents approved the change to address EGSC's declining enrollment and improve academic programs in the region — an implementation team from both schools will form and begin campus listening sessions before a final SACSCOC vote finalizes details more than a year from now. G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 The Georgia State Supreme Court held oral arguments on Sapelo Island zoning cases involving a referendum to repeal an ordinance that allowed larger homes in a community with one of the state's last Gullah Geechee communities. The justices must decide whether to lift the injunction on the ordinance and let the special election move forward, with a ruling expected in the coming months. WTOC 11
